Get-AzureStorSimpleJob
Získá úlohy StorSimple.
Poznámka:
Rutiny, na které odkazuje tato dokumentace, slouží ke správě starších prostředků Azure, které používají rozhraní API Azure Service Manageru (ASM). Tento starší modul PowerShellu se nedoporučuje při vytváření nových prostředků, protože ASM je naplánované pro vyřazení z provozu. Další informace najdete v části Vyřazení Azure Service Manageru.
Modul Az PowerShell je doporučený modul PowerShellu pro správu prostředků Azure Resource Manageru (ARM) pomocí PowerShellu.
Syntax
Get-AzureStorSimpleJob
[-DeviceName <String>]
[-InstanceId <String>]
[-Status <String>]
[-Type <String>]
[-From <DateTime>]
[-To <DateTime>]
[-Skip <Int32>]
[-First <Int32>]
[-Profile <AzureSMProfile>]
[<CommonParameters>]
Description
Rutina Get-AzureStorSimpleJob získá úlohy Azure StorSimple. Zadejte ID instance pro získání konkrétní úlohy. Zadejte další parametry pro omezení úloh, které tato rutina získá.
Tato rutina vrátí maximálně 200 úloh. Pokud existuje více než 200 úloh, získejte zbývající úlohy pomocí parametrů First a Skip . Pokud zadáte hodnotu 100 pro Skip a 50 pro First, tato rutina nevrací prvních 100 výsledků. Vrátí dalších 50 výsledků po 100, které přeskočí.
Příklady
Příklad 1: Získání úlohy pomocí ID
PS C:\>Get-AzureStorSimpleJob -InstanceId "574f47e0-44e9-495c-b8a5-0203c57ebf6d"
BackupPolicy :
BackupTimeStamp : 1/1/0001 12:00:00 AM
BackupType : CloudSnapshot
DataStats : Microsoft.WindowsAzure.Management.StorSimple.Models.DataStatistics
Device : Microsoft.WindowsAzure.Management.StorSimple.Models.CisBaseObject
Entity : Microsoft.WindowsAzure.Management.StorSimple.Models.CisBaseObject
ErrorDetails : {}
HideProgressDetails : False
InstanceId : 574f47e0-44e9-495c-b8a5-0203c57ebf6d
IsInstantRestoreComplete : False
IsJobCancellable : True
JobDetails : Microsoft.WindowsAzure.Management.StorSimple.Models.JobStatusInfo
Name : 26447caf-59bb-41c9-a028-3224d296c7dc
Progress : 100
SourceDevice : Microsoft.WindowsAzure.Management.StorSimple.Models.CisBaseObject
SourceEntity : Microsoft.WindowsAzure.Management.StorSimple.Models.CisBaseObject
SourceVolume : Microsoft.WindowsAzure.Management.StorSimple.Models.CisBaseObject
Status : Completed
TimeStats : Microsoft.WindowsAzure.Management.StorSimple.Models.TimeStatistics
Type : Backup
Volume : Microsoft.WindowsAzure.Management.StorSimple.Models.CisBaseObject
Tento příkaz získá informace pro úlohu, která má zadané ID.
Příklad 2: Získání úloh pomocí názvu zařízení
PS C:\>Get-AzureStorSimpleJob -DeviceName "8600-Bravo 001" -First 2
InstanceId Type Status DeviceName StartTime Progress
---------- ---- ------ ---------- --------- --------
1997c33f-bfcc-4d08-9aba-28068340a1f9 Backup Running 8600-Bravo 001 4/15/2015 1:30:02 PM 92
85074062-ef6a-408a-b6c9-2a0904bb99ca Backup Completed 8600-Bravo 001 4/15/2015 1:30:02 PM 100
Tento příkaz získá informace o úlohách pro zařízení s názvem 8600-Bravo 001. Příkaz získá první dvě úlohy pro zařízení.
Příklad 3: Získání dokončených úloh
PS C:\>Get-AzureStorSimpleJob -Status "Completed" -Skip 10 -First 2
Tento příkaz získá dokončené úlohy. Příkaz získá pouze první dvě úlohy, jakmile přeskočí prvních deset úloh.
Příklad 4: Získání ručních úloh zálohování
PS C:\>Get-AzureStorSimpleJob -Type "ManualBackup"
Tento příkaz získá úlohy typu ručního zálohování.
Příklad 5: Získání úloh mezi zadanými časy
PS C:\>$StartTime = Get-Date -Year 2015 -Month 3 -Day 10
PS C:\> $EndTime = Get-Date -Year 2015 -Month 3 -Day 11 -Hour 12 -Minute 15
PS C:\>Get-AzureStorSimpleJob -DeviceName "Device07" -From $StartTime -To $EndTime
První dva příkazy vytvářejí objekty DateTime pomocí rutiny Get-Date.
Příkazy ukládají nové časy do $StartTime a $EndTime proměnných.
Další informace potřebujete zadáním Get-Help Get-Date
.
Poslední příkaz získá úlohy pro zařízení s názvem Device07 mezi časy uloženými v $StartTime a $EndTime.
Parametry
-DeviceName
Určuje název zařízení StorSimple.
Typ: | String |
Position: | Named |
výchozí hodnota: | None |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-First
Získá pouze zadaný počet objektů. Zadejte počet objektů, které chcete získat.
Typ: | Int32 |
Position: | Named |
výchozí hodnota: | False |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-From
Určuje počáteční datum a čas pro úlohy, které tato rutina získá.
Typ: | DateTime |
Position: | Named |
výchozí hodnota: | None |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-InstanceId
Určuje ID úlohy, která se má získat.
Typ: | String |
Position: | Named |
výchozí hodnota: | None |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Profile
Určuje profil Azure, ze kterého se tato rutina čte. Pokud nezadáte profil, tato rutina načte z místního výchozího profilu.
Typ: | AzureSMProfile |
Position: | Named |
výchozí hodnota: | None |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Skip
Přeskočí zadaný počet objektů a pak získá zbývající objekty. Zadejte počet objektů, které chcete přeskočit.
Typ: | Int32 |
Position: | Named |
výchozí hodnota: | False |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Status
Určuje stav. Tento parametr přijímá tyto hodnoty:
- Spuštěno
- Dokončeno
- Zrušeno
- Neúspěšný
- Probíhá zrušení
- CompletedWithErrors
Typ: | String |
Position: | Named |
výchozí hodnota: | None |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-To
Určuje koncové datum a čas pro úlohy, které tato rutina získá.
Typ: | DateTime |
Position: | Named |
výchozí hodnota: | None |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Type
Určuje typ úlohy. Tento parametr přijímá tyto hodnoty:
- Backup
- ManualBackup
- Obnovení
- CloneWorkflow
- DeviceRestore
- Aktualizovat
- SupportPackage
- VirtualApplianceProvisioning
Typ: | String |
Position: | Named |
výchozí hodnota: | None |
Vyžadováno: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
Vstupy
None
Vstup do této rutiny nelze převést.
Výstupy
IList\<DeviceJobDetails\>, DeviceJobDetails
Tato rutina vrátí seznam objektů podrobností úlohy, nebo pokud zadáte parametr InstanceID , vrátí jeden objekt podrobností úlohy.